Mixel® is a leading provider of Silicon-proven mixed-signal IP cores to the semiconductor and electronics industries. Mixel licenses high-performance analog and mixed-signal IP cores to the communications, consumer and storage markets for use in system-on-chip, ASICs and embedded systems. Mixel's mixed-signal IP portfolio includes high performance PHYs, SerDes, PLLs, DLLs, and analog building blocks. They are used in Mobile applications such as MIPI, MDDI, networking and storage applications, and a variety of transceivers.

MXL-PHY-MMU-RX3
Product Category: Semiconductor IP
Other: Mixed-Signal Product

Mixel® Inc. announced the availability of the first MIPI/MDDI unified PHY IP solution The MXL-PHY-MMU-RX3 is a compliant with the VESA Version 1.2 specification and the MIPI Alliance Standard for D-PHY Mobile Display Digital Interface version 1.0. It consists of 4 lanes: 1 Clock/Strobe lane, 1 bidirectional data lane and 2 unidirectional data lanes, which makes it suitable for display interface applications. The MDDI and MIPI blocks share the same signal and supply pins. The receive termination is embedded and can be used for both MDDI and MIPI. Once the Display module is qualified it can be used for both MIPI and MDDI resulting in faster time to market and in area and cost savings.

MXL-PHY-MIPI
Product Category: Semiconductor IP
Other: Mixed-Signal Product

The MXL-PHY-MIPI is a high-frequency low-power, low-cost, source-synchronous, physical Layer compliant with the MIPI Alliance Standard for D-PHY 1.0. Although it is primarily used for connecting cameras and display devices to a cost processor, it can also be used for many other portable applications. Mixel was the first IP provider to have this IP silicon-proven. High-Speed signals have a low voltage swing, while Low-Power signals have large swing. High-Speed functions are used for High-Speed Data traffic while low power functions are mostly used for control. Mixel 2nd generation D-PHY has been optimized for low power and small area, and has been licensed by several of Mixel customers in a number of different foundries.

MXL-PLL-SYN-LIF-DC
Product Category: Semiconductor IP
Other: Mixed-Signal Special

The MXL-PLL-SYN-LIF-DC has two input frequency ranges which can be as low as 32KHZ. The high input frequency range is from 8MHz - 20MHz with a maximum output frequency of 550MHZ. All output programmable dividers produce 50% duty cycle for even and odd divisors. It incorporates two programmable output dividers, bypass mode, and supports a full power down mode. It is a high performance, low power dissipation, highly programmable PLL based frequency synthesizer. Highly integrated and requires no external components. Differential circuit techniques are employed to attain low jitter in the noisy environment typical of multi-million gates digital chip. The circuit is designed in a modular fashion and desensitized to process variations. This facilitates process migration, and results in robust design.
